Form Grammars
Form grammars make the most of rule-based methods to generate and rework geometric shapes. These guidelines can encode stylistic conventions, structural ideas, or different design constraints. Architects can use form grammars to discover variations on a specific architectural fashion or to generate advanced constructing layouts based mostly on predefined guidelines. This method ensures consistency inside a design language and facilitates the creation of intricate, rule-governed kinds.
-
Fractals and L-Programs
Fractals and L-systems present mechanisms for creating advanced, self-similar patterns present in nature. L-systems, or Lindenmayer methods, use iterative rewriting guidelines to generate branching constructions like crops and timber. Fractals, based mostly on recursive mathematical formulation, create intricate patterns with infinite element. These strategies enable designers to include natural kinds and complicated geometries into their creations, bridging the hole between pure and synthetic aesthetics.

5. Digital Sculpting
Digital sculpting represents a big evolution within the realm of three-dimensional modeling, bridging the hole between conventional sculpting strategies and the precision provided by computational instruments. Its connection to the broader idea of “sculpt by science calculator” lies in its reliance on underlying mathematical ideas and algorithms to symbolize and manipulate digital clay. Digital sculpting software program makes use of subtle mathematical representations of surfaces, corresponding to NURBS (Non-Uniform Rational B-Splines) or subdivision surfaces, to outline the type of the digital mannequin. These mathematical underpinnings enable for clean, steady surfaces that may be manipulated with a excessive diploma of precision and management. Adjustments to the mannequin are calculated and rendered in real-time, offering quick suggestions to the artist and enabling an iterative sculpting course of akin to working with bodily clay.
The “science calculator” side turns into evident in a number of key functionalities of digital sculpting software program. Instruments like brushes and deformers function based mostly on algorithms that work together with the underlying mathematical illustration of the floor. For instance, a clean brush may apply a Gaussian blur to the floor normals, whereas a pinch brush may contract the vertices round a central level based mostly on a falloff curve. These operations are usually not arbitrary; they’re based mostly on mathematical calculations that guarantee predictable and controllable outcomes. Moreover, options like dynamic topology enable the software program to robotically add or take away polygons based mostly on the sculpting actions, sustaining a constant stage of element throughout the mannequin. This dynamic adjustment is pushed by algorithms that analyze the curvature and density of the mesh, making certain optimum topology for the sculpted kind.
